Rating: 4 out of 5 stars - Well made comedy, has become a Cult Film.
A young man(Steve Guttenburg) is attending a `low tech` Med School in Central America. While he meets Students from Med School (Julie Hagerty, Curtis Armstrong and Julie Kavner). Without the Knowledge of the Head Doctor of Med School (Alan Arkin). The Studients set up a Medical Clinc in a nearby Village, where the Care is Inacceptable.

Directed by Harvey Miller (Getting Away with Murder) made a Satisfying Comedy. Good Comic Performances by the Cast. A Box Office flop in Theaters but it`s has life on ... Read More
